快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个面向程序员的Ubuntu搜狗输入法优化配置指南应用,包含:1) 开发环境专用词库 2) 编程术语快捷输入 3) Markdown/代码注释模板 4) 终端输入优化方案 5) 常见问题解决方案。使用Flask开发Web界面,支持配置方案分享和社区贡献。 - 点击'项目生成'按钮,等待项目生成完整后预览效果
作为长期使用Ubuntu开发的程序员,中文输入一直是影响效率的关键环节。今天分享我通过搜狗输入法打造专属编程输入环境的实战经验,特别针对代码注释、文档编写和终端操作等高频场景做了深度优化。
1. 为什么选择搜狗输入法
- Linux版原生支持:官方提供的deb安装包完美兼容Ubuntu各版本
- 云词库同步:跨设备保存个人词库,重装系统不丢失配置
- 自定义短语:可设置编程术语快捷输入(如输入"zk"自动补全"注释")
- 皮肤定制:深色模式护眼,适合长时间编码
2. 核心优化方案
- 开发环境词库建设
- 导入Python/Java等语言的关键字库
- 添加常用框架术语(Spring/Django/React等)
自定义团队内部技术名词
编程快捷指令
- 设置
//自动联想代码注释模板 - 配置
md快捷输出Markdown语法 常用报错信息预存(如NullPointerException)
终端输入优化
- 调整候选词竖排显示避免遮挡命令
- 关闭自动英文切换(避免sudo等命令误触发)
设置中文标点映射(如
<>保持半角)异常处理方案
- 输入法崩溃时快速重启服务
- 词库冲突时重置配置
- 缺失依赖项自动修复
3. 高级技巧
- 通过
fcitx-configtool调整候选词数量(建议5-7个) - 禁用不常用的输入法引擎减少内存占用
- 定期导出词库备份防止意外丢失
- 使用云输入弥补本地词库不足
4. 实战效果
经过两周实际使用测试: - 代码注释效率提升40% - 技术文档撰写速度提高35% - 终端操作误输入减少60% - 团队协作时术语统一率100%
这套方案已经通过InsCode(快马)平台的Web界面实现可视化配置,支持一键导出设置分享给队友。平台提供的实时预览功能让我能立即测试不同配置效果,省去了反复重启输入法的麻烦。
对于需要频繁切换中英文输入的开发者,这套定制方案能显著提升Ubuntu环境下的工作效率。建议根据个人习惯调整快捷指令,逐步形成肌肉记忆。
快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个面向程序员的Ubuntu搜狗输入法优化配置指南应用,包含:1) 开发环境专用词库 2) 编程术语快捷输入 3) Markdown/代码注释模板 4) 终端输入优化方案 5) 常见问题解决方案。使用Flask开发Web界面,支持配置方案分享和社区贡献。 - 点击'项目生成'按钮,等待项目生成完整后预览效果
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考